About Mohammad Reza Keyvanpour
Mohammad Reza Keyvanpour is a scholar working on Software, Computer Vision and Pattern Recognition and Artificial Intelligence, having authored 196 papers that have together received 1.5k indexed citations. Recurring topics across this work include Software Engineering Research (22 papers), Software Testing and Debugging Techniques (21 papers) and Software Reliability and Analysis Research (19 papers). The work is most often cited by research in Software (116 citations), Computer Vision and Pattern Recognition (442 citations) and Artificial Intelligence (651 citations). Mohammad Reza Keyvanpour has collaborated with scholars based in Iran and United States. Frequent co-authors include Behrooz Masoumi, Arash Sharifi, Hamed Hassanzadeh, Reza Azmi, Azam Bastanfard, Mohammad Bagher Menhaj, Soheila Molaei, Saeed Mozaffari, Saeed Parsa and Mohammad Shojafar. Their work appears in journals such as SHILAP Revista de lepidopterología, Expert Systems with Applications and Information Sciences.
